Jacqueline Fernandez (August 11, 1985 – present) is an actress and model born in Nassau, Bahamas, who built a successful career in Indian cinema. She studied mass communication in Australia before winning the Miss Universe Bahamas title in 2006 and competing in the Miss Universe pageant. After relocating to India, she made her Bollywood debut in 'Aladin' (2009) and quickly became established as a leading actress in Hindi films. Her filmography includes major productions such as 'Housefull' franchise films, 'Race 2,' 'Kick,' and 'Race 3,' often playing glamorous roles opposite top Bollywood stars. Beyond acting, Fernandez has worked as a model, dancer, and brand ambassador for various products and fashion lines. She is known for her participation in television dance competition shows and her involvement in charitable causes. Fernandez has become one of the few foreign-born actresses to achieve significant success in the Indian film industry, bridging international and Bollywood cinema. Her career represents the globalization of Indian entertainment and the increasing presence of international talent in mainstream Hindi films.

Jacqueline
French origin
“The French feminine form of Jacques, derived from Jacobus and Hebrew Ya'akov, meaning 'supplanter.' Jacqueline rose to prominence through French and British nobility and gained widespread international recognition in the 20th century. The name embodies timeless elegance, sophistication, and a poised, graceful character that has transcended generations.”
